The antiwar movement is back on the streets. Thousands marched on April 9 in New York and April 10 in San Francisco.

These demonstrations represented an important step forward for the United National Antiwar Committee and the antiwar movement as a whole. The new antiwar movement needs to oppose the US foreign wars but also defend the domestic victims of the "war on terror," the Muslims who are being attacked. It must connect the dots between the money spent on war and the attacks on unions and cuts to education and needed programs. This is what these demonstrations on April 9 and 10 did.

Major gains were made in bringing together the antiwar movement and important section of the Muslim community which is ready to come out in opposition to war and Islamophobia. The large number of Muslims who were present, including the leadership of the Muslim community in New York said to the world, Muslims are for peace not terror and they are ready to join with non-Muslims and fight back against the Islamophobia that is growing in the US.

Other communities also joined our rallies, including significant South Asian, Latino, Pilipino and Black organizations. The rallies were diverse and youthful. These are the new faces of the antiwar movement.
